Transaction 1096f9933c674a6708871b79b943e05790ffe04419385863c95df39db7137d0a
1 Input
1 Output
-
1096f9933c674a6708871b79b943e05790ffe04419385863c95df39db7137d0a:0
- value
- 696352
- script pubkey
- OP_0 OP_PUSHBYTES_20 e21611144b7ad07a807b6eeb64b4aa8a93b60d48
- address
- bc1qugtpz9zt0tg84qrmdm4kfd9232fmvr2g3vaxhg